The words of adhan (???????) are wonderful, lovely, and full of the wisdom of the spirit. The Muezzin calls, that is, come to success, "Hayya 'alal falaah". One asks what success one is called upon to accomplish.
"The Qur'an tells us to pray for what is good in the world and hereafter, "fidduniya hasanah wa fil akhirati hasanah... As promised in the adhan, 'success' also means both achievements. Surely, we all know that we will find prosperity in the afterlife by conducting mandatory actions dictated by Islam, but how does this give us success in this world? Let us discuss the areas in which a Muslim in this world finds success. We also work hard to find answers to our basic schooling, jobs, legal aid, job counseling, marital advice, protection and security, financial well-being, civil conflicts, etc. issues.
These are the "worldly" issues that each Muslim is seeking to address, regardless of nationality. The real sense of Hayya' alal falaah, that success is connected with both Salat and the mosques, has been lost. #Success was connected with Masjid by Allah SWT. It is very understandable that Allah also wants us to be open to fellow Muslims and wants to be a place where any person can expect love, compassion, and support for their problems with his house (mosque). "The Holy Prophet is said to have said, "None of you really believes until what he loves for himself is loved by his brother.
